Never been to Waco but it's a BUNCH closer than Limestone, may have to give it a try!!

I think my kids would like working a little jig more than dropping a minnow anyway. Are they pretty picky on the presentation, or is it more about the right depth??

They are not picky, I had a 8 year old that was throwing the end of his rod all over the place. Get them over a brush pile and bring it a couple cranks off the bottom and they will get bit
